Men's day dinner
Join Australian actor William McInnes and athlete Mark Knowles for a free International Men's Day dinner on Thursday 15 November at The Centre, Beaudesert.
 
Mayor Greg Christensen has issued an open invitation to celebrate positive male role models over a lively discussion about the resilience and strength of family-orientated men.
 
TV star and author William McInnes, who is best known for his role in Australian classic Blue Heelers and more recently starred in Rake, will discuss his family memories with laughs and share poignant stories from his new book, Fatherhood.
 
Hockey legend Mark Knowles will tell of his time at the helm of the Australian Kookaburras and how a boy from the bush made it all the way to lead the Australian Commonwealth Games Team in 2018.
 
Cr Christensen said it was a pleasure to be able to welcome men from across the Scenic Rim for the International Men's Day celebration.
 
"It is a time to catch up with good mates, old mates and even meet some new mates," he said.
 
"I am looking forward to listening to our speakers discuss their family lives and balancing that with their successful careers.
 
"It is a worthwhile conversation to enable us to commend Scenic Rim men for being the positive role models that they are."
